    Anderson and Reimer are your two standouts here, by a long shot, in my opinion. Varly and Smith haven't really proven much yet, despite getting chances to do so in the past. They may have great seasons, but I wouldn't bet on it.

    Anderson and Reimer are tough to choose from. I'd decide that by which team you figure will get more wins. Both are solid goalies. I just like Anderson's .939 save percentage in Ottawa last year, even though it was only 18 games. Some players just click with certain teams.
